Many manufacturers advise that you must change your splitter’s hydraulic fluid after every 50 hours. if the hydraulic fluid is of high quality, this will can easily give you around 150 hours of log splitter operation. this will largely depend on the type of logs you’re splitting and how hard it is to split. How often should you change hydraulic fluid in a log splitter? a lot of manufacturers will advise that you should change your fluid after every 50 hours. however, if the fluid used is of high quality this will usually give you around 150 hours of log splitting operation. Hydraulic fluid replacement: annually: change hydraulic fluid once a year or per manufacturer’s recommendation. hydraulic hose inspection: every 6 months: look for cracks, leaks, or signs of wear. replace if needed. filter cleaning replacement: every 6 months: clean or replace hydraulic and air filters. lubrication of moving parts: every 3 months.
